Hello,
I have just bought a new Kindle Oasis 2017 and I was trying to move all my ebooks and collections bought from Amazon on this new device.
I have more than 1.000 books to move and the first problem was that not all covers showed up, but I am solving this issue manually by deleting the book from the device and reloading it again. It is not painless, but it can slowly be done.
What is more worrying for me is that some of my collections have "holes". These holes show up like in the attached pic
And adding to that, sometimes if I re-load an ebook in one collection, and move to another collection without waiting for the book to load completely, the loaded ebook may appear also in another collection.
Some of these problems disappear when I do a restart, but not always.
Does anybody ever met the same problem ?
Bruno
Yes, I have had the "hole" issue, especially when downloading a load of books. Not sure why but it has only occurred occasionally.
